About

I am an academician in the field of Electronics and Communication Engineering with extensive experience in teaching, mentoring, and academic development. My contributions include curriculum design, academic planning, and the incorporation of emerging technologies into the learning framework to ensure students are equipped with contemporary knowledge and skills.

In addition to academic responsibilities, I have guided and coached students for competitive examinations such as GATE and ESE, enabling many of them to secure admissions in reputed institutions including IITs and NITs, as well as achieve professional success. My focus has consistently been on fostering academic excellence, innovation, and holistic student development.

Educational Details

  • Ph.D (ECE), JNTU College of Engineering, Ananthapur – July 2011
  • M.Tech (EI), NIT Warangal – June 1993 
  • B.Tech (ECE), KSRM College of Engineering, Cuddapah – May 1987 

Professional Background

  • Professor & Dean of ECE Dept, ACE Engineering College, Ankushapur – 2024 to Till Date
  •  Professor, ECE Department, ACE Engineering College, Ankushapur – 2011 to 2024
  • Professor & HOD of ECE Dept, G Pulla Reddy Engineering College –2005 to 2011
  • Associate Professor, G Pulla Reddy Engineering College –2000 to 2005
  • Assistant Professor, G Pulla Reddy Engineering College –1994 to 2000
